对象存储服务的存储单位,深入解析对象存储服务,存储单位与二副本机制的应用
- 综合资讯
- 2024-12-03 21:46:50
- 1

深入解析对象存储服务的存储单位,探讨其与二副本机制的应用。存储单位定义了存储资源的基本单元,而二副本机制则保障数据的安全性和可靠性。本文将详细介绍对象存储服务的存储单位...
深入解析对象存储服务的存储单位,探讨其与二副本机制的应用。存储单位定义了存储资源的基本单元,而二副本机制则保障数据的安全性和可靠性。本文将详细介绍对象存储服务的存储单位及二副本机制的工作原理和应用场景。
随着互联网的快速发展,数据量呈爆炸式增长,传统的存储方式已无法满足需求,为了应对这一挑战,对象存储服务(Object Storage Service)应运而生,对象存储服务以其高效、安全、可扩展的特点,成为数据存储领域的重要选择,本文将深入解析对象存储服务的存储单位与二副本机制,帮助读者全面了解其工作原理。
对象存储服务的存储单位
1、存储单位概述
对象存储服务的存储单位为“对象”,每个对象包含三个部分:元数据、数据、访问控制信息,元数据描述了对象的属性,如名称、大小、类型等;数据为实际存储内容;访问控制信息则用于权限管理。
2、对象存储服务的存储结构
对象存储服务采用分层存储结构,主要包括以下层次:
(1)容器(Container):容器是对象存储服务的最基本存储单位,用于组织和管理对象,每个容器包含多个对象。
(2)对象(Object):对象是存储数据的单元,由元数据、数据和访问控制信息组成。
(3)桶(Bucket):桶是容器的高级组织形式,用于在更大范围内管理和组织容器,每个桶可以包含多个容器。
(4)数据中心(Data Center):数据中心是存储服务的物理设施,包括多个桶。
二副本机制
1、二副本概述
对象存储服务的二副本机制是指在存储过程中,每个对象在存储系统内部保存两个副本,以提高数据的可靠性和安全性,当其中一个副本发生故障时,系统可以自动切换到另一个副本,确保数据不丢失。
2、二副本机制的实现
(1)数据副本
对象存储服务在存储数据时,会将数据同时写入两个不同的物理存储设备上,这样,即使其中一个设备出现故障,另一个设备仍然可以提供数据访问。
(2)副本复制
对象存储服务采用异步复制的方式,将数据副本从源节点复制到目标节点,复制过程中,系统会保证数据的一致性,确保两个副本的数据完全相同。
(3)副本同步
在数据副本复制过程中,对象存储服务会定期进行副本同步,确保副本数据的一致性,同步过程会检查副本数据是否一致,若不一致,则进行修复。
(4)副本管理
对象存储服务会对副本进行管理,包括副本的创建、删除、迁移等操作,系统会定期检查副本的健康状况,确保副本可用。
二副本机制的优势
1、提高数据可靠性
二副本机制可以确保数据在存储过程中不丢失,即使其中一个副本出现故障,另一个副本仍然可以提供数据访问。
2、提高数据安全性
二副本机制可以有效防止数据被恶意删除或篡改,因为至少需要两个副本同时被修改才能影响数据。
3、提高数据访问速度
二副本机制可以实现数据的本地化存储,降低数据访问延迟,提高数据访问速度。
4、提高系统可扩展性
二副本机制可以方便地进行数据扩展,因为新增的副本可以快速复制到其他节点上。
对象存储服务的存储单位为“对象”,采用二副本机制确保数据的可靠性和安全性,本文深入解析了对象存储服务的存储单位与二副本机制,帮助读者全面了解其工作原理,随着数据量的不断增长,对象存储服务将在数据存储领域发挥越来越重要的作用。
本文链接:https://www.zhitaoyun.cn/1296984.html
发表评论